Wheelchair Assistant – Why Ora ProgramFixed term, full time, 1.0FTE (80 hours per fortnight)Health New Zealand | Te Whatu Ora is firmly grounded in the principles of Te Tiriti o Waitangi and is committed to building a health system that serves all New Zealanders.About the RoleGreat opportunity for something new, this position is responsible for the repairs, maintenance and modification of wheelchairs, as requested by therapists and/or Wheelchair Technician.
The role includes repairs for equipment / wheelchair funded through Enable NZ, ACC, Hospital or private customers. Repairs, maintenance can be completed at the wheelchair department, main residence or in the community.The Wheelchair Assistant will assist with the implementation of appropriate repair and review of wheelchairs under the guidance, support and/or supervision of a therapist or Wheelchair technician.
This role covers all age groups and the Taranaki region.Please click here to view the position descriptionAbout the Team/Service/ LocationHealth New Zealand | Te Whatu Ora Taranaki employs approximately 350 allied health professionals across its services, and we’re growing our inpatient physical health rehabilitation team by 60%.

You will be joining a friendly team that is diverse in skills and experience, a team that welcomes collaboration, and that values the contribution of each team member.
